Introduction to Hydraulic Motors

Hydraulic motors are essential components in various industrial applications, offering efficient power conversion for tasks requiring high torque at low speeds. Understanding their operation can significantly enhance system performance and longevity.

Critical Considerations During Operation

When operating hydraulic motors, several factors must be taken into account to ensure optimal functionality. These include proper fluid viscosity, regular maintenance to prevent wear, and ensuring compatibility with other system components. Maintaining Efficiency

To maintain efficiency in hydraulic devices, regular inspections and adherence to operational guidelines are crucial. The use of sensors can help monitor performance metrics, allowing for timely adjustments and improvements in efficiency. Additionally, investing in modern technologies that offer enhanced control can ensure system reliability and reduce downtime.
